About
Quick facts: The square is located in the heart of Kaunas and was the site of 16th-century markets. Every year, thousands gather here for cultural events and fairs.
Highlights: The bell tower standing in the middle of the square plays the city's anthem every hour, which many locals still listen to out of respect. Here you will find the café called "Venezia," where locals often gather over an authentic Lithuanian coffee.
